Watch Seth's talk at Nordic Business Forum - Leadership and Innovation in Changing Times. During this session, Seth explained how game-changing leadership leads to game-changing innovation.
00:00 - Intro
00:07 - Keynote
20:02 - Q&A Session With Lisa Bodell
About Seth Godin
Seth Godin is the author of 19 books that have been bestsellers around the world and have been translated into more than 35 languages. He’s also the founder of the altMBA and The Marketing Seminar, online workshops that have transformed the work of thousands of people.
